【问题标题】:How to get Youtube "Auto-generated CC" with Node.Js using Youtube Api?如何使用 Youtube Api 使用 Node.Js 获取 Youtube“自动生成的 CC”?
【发布时间】:2018-02-19 10:34:36
【问题描述】:

如何为从我自己的帐户上传的 Youtube 视频以 XML 或 srt 格式自动生成字幕。

如果没有办法使用Youtube-api,还有其他方法吗?

【问题讨论】:

    标签: node.js youtube-api


    【解决方案1】:

    您可能需要参考此tutorial 以获取 youtube 视频的字幕。

    这是一个返回 Promise 的示例,它传递了生成的字幕。

    var getYoutubeSubtitles = require('@joegesualdo/get-youtube-subtitles-node');
    
    let videoId = 'q_q61B-DyPk'
    
    getYoutubeSubtitles(videoId, {type: 'nonauto'})
    .then(subtitles => {
      console.log(subtitles)
    })
    .catch(err => {
      console.log(err)
    })
    

    其他参考资料:

    【讨论】:

    • 我认为答案是否定的。
    猜你喜欢
    • 1970-01-01
    • 2014-03-14
    • 1970-01-01
    • 2012-07-04
    • 2012-09-18
    • 2016-09-07
    • 2015-10-12
    • 2013-04-23
    • 2017-02-06
    相关资源
    最近更新 更多